Output 3a62104d2c21058e93d921541d5a3e93eff502d38d2fd9d7cb43a813b81248c8:0

value
294
script pubkey
OP_0 OP_PUSHBYTES_20 86005d240a9157bba718b2c5b19a83f14cb49656
address
bc1qscq96fq2j9tmhfccktzmrx5r79xtf9jknezegx
transaction
3a62104d2c21058e93d921541d5a3e93eff502d38d2fd9d7cb43a813b81248c8
confirmations
119963
spent
true